Troubleshooting Common Frigidaire Refrigerator Issues
Frigidaire refrigerators are known for their durability and reliability, but like any appliance, they can sometimes experience problems. Luckily, many common Frigidaire refrigerator issues can be easily resolved at home with a little bit of troubleshooting.
Here are some tips to help you determine and fix common Frigidaire refrigerator problems:
- Look over the power connection: Make sure the refrigerator is plugged in properly and that the outlet is working.
- Review the door seals: Dirty or damaged seals can cause the refrigerator to lose coolant. Clean them with a mild detergent and water, or replace them if necessary.
- Pay attention to the thermostat: If the thermostat is set too high, the refrigerator may not cool properly. Adjust the thermostat to the recommended setting.
- Hear for unusual clicks: Strange noises can indicate a problem with the compressor.
If you are unable to fix the issue yourself, it is best to contact a qualified appliance repair technician.

Maintaining Your Frigidaire Refrigerator Clean and Fresh
A clean refrigerator is a happy refrigerator! Regular cleaning of your Frigidaire appliance helps to keep your food fresher and prevents unpleasant smells. Start by removing all items from the fridge and giving it a thorough wipe down with a solution of warm water and vinegar. Don't forget to clean the shelves and any removable parts. For stubborn spots, try using a paste of baking soda and water. After cleaning, dry everything thoroughly before putting your food items back in.
To help combat lingering odors, you can place an open box of coffee grounds inside the fridge. Replace it every few weeks. Regular ventilation also helps keep your fridge smelling fresh. Simply leave the door ajar for a short period of time each day to allow air to circulate.
